Oracle ADG 技术简介
Oracle Active Data Guard(ADG)是Oracle数据库的一项重要技术,旨在提供高可用性和灾难恢复能力。它建立在Oracle Data Guard技术的基础上,通过实时数据复制和自动故障转移,确保数据库在故障时仍能提供服务。
主要特性和优势
-
实时数据复制:ADG通过将主数据库的变更实时复制到一个或多个辅助数据库,确保数据的实时可用性和一致性。这些辅助数据库可以用于读操作,从而减轻主数据库的负载。
-
自动故障转移:在主数据库发生故障时,ADG可以自动将辅助数据库切换为可读写模式,以继续提供服务。这种故障转移是无感知的,对应用程序和最终用户是透明的。
-
灾难恢复:通过在远程位置部署辅助数据库,ADG可以在灾难发生时快速恢复服务。远程位置的数据库可以承担灾难后的主要工作负载,从而减少服务中断的风险。
-
高性能:ADG利用Oracle的高效复制技术,确保在数据复制过程中尽可能少地影响主数据库的性能。这使得ADG适用于高负载和关键性应用场景。
-
管理简单:Oracle提供了丰富的管理工具和自动化功能,简化了ADG的配置、监控和维护过程。管理员可以轻松设置数据保护策略并监视复制的状态。
应用场景
-
高可用性要求:对于那些需要24/7可用性的关键业务应用,ADG提供了即时故障转移和数据保护的解决方案。
-
数据保护与灾难恢复:企业可以利用ADG在地理上分离的位置部署辅助数据库,以应对灾难并确保业务连续性。
-
读写分离:通过将读操作分流到辅助数据库,ADG可以改善主数据库的性能和可扩展性。
总结
Oracle ADG技术通过数据复制、自动故障转移和灾难恢复功能,为企业提供了强大的数据库保护和高可用性解决方案。它不仅仅是数据保护的手段,更是确保业务连续性和性能优化的关键工具,适用于各种规模和类型的企业应用。
通过合理配置和管理,企业可以最大化利用Oracle ADG技术的优势,保障关键业务数据的安全和可用性,降低因故障或灾难而导致的业务损失风险。




